The global Business Intelligence (BI) market size is projected to grow from approximately $25 billion in 2023 to an estimated $55 billion by 2032, reflecting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 9%. This growth is primarily driven by increased data generation across various industries and the rising need to make informed business decisions.
One of the most significant growth factors in the BI market is the exponential increase in data generation. With the advent of IoT, social media, and digital transactions, businesses are inundated with data. Organizations are recognizing the importance of analyzing this data to gain actionable insights, which in turn drives the demand for BI solutions. These solutions enable businesses to make data-driven decisions, optimize operations, and gain a competitive edge, boosting the overall market growth.
Another critical driver is the growing adoption of cloud-based BI solutions. Cloud BI offers scalability, flexibility, and cost-effectiveness, making it an attractive option for businesses of all sizes. The shift towards remote working and the need for real-time data access have further accelerated the adoption of cloud-based BI solutions. This trend is expected to continue, contributing significantly to the market's expansion in the coming years.
Moreover, advancements in art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) are enhancing the capabilities of BI tools. These technologies enable predictive analytics, natural language processing, and advanced data visualization, making BI solutions more intuitive and powerful. As AI and ML continue to evolve, their integration into BI platforms will create new growth opportunities and further propel the market.
Regionally, North America holds the largest share of the BI market, driven by the early adoption of advanced technologies and the presence of major BI vendors. However, the Asia Pacific region is expected to witness the highest growth rate during the forecast period. The rapid digital transformation, increasing investments in IT infrastructure, and growing awareness about the benefits of BI solutions in countries like China and India are significant factors contributing to this regional growth.

The market is witnessing significant growth in the BFSI sector due to the complete digitization of core business processes and the adoption of customer-centric business models. With the emergence of new financial technologies such as cashless banking, phone banking, and e-wallets, an extensive amount of digital data is generated every day. Analyzing this data provides valuable insights into system performance, customer behavior and expectations, demographic trends, and future growth areas. Business intelligence dashboards, in-memory analytics, anomaly detection, decision support systems, and KPI dashboards are essential tools used in the BFSI sector for data analysis. The Business Intelligence Market Faces Headwinds from Data Security Risks: Data security poses a significant challenge for the BI market. Centralized data systems are increasingly vulnerable to cyberattacks, while international regulations such as GDPR and CCPA impose expensive compliance requirements. Data breaches, legal repercussions, and consumer skepticism hinder adoption, underscoring the importance of a robust security framework and responsible data governance.

The Business Intelligence (BI) Software industry in the US has experienced substantial growth, driven primarily by surging demand for data-driven decision-making amidst increasing online business activities. The pandemic significantly accelerated this trend as companies shifted their operations online and invested in sophisticated analytics tools. In 2024, the industry is valued at $36.4 billion, with revenue climbing 6.4% during 2024 alone. The industry has benefited from investments in cloud-based services and AI solutions, which have been critical growth drivers, leading to profit accounting for 24.6% of revenue during the current year. Mergers and acquisitions (M&A) have been pivotal in reshaping the BI landscape. Prominent firms like Salesforce, Google and Microsoft are leveraging their robust financial positions to acquire innovative startups, expanding their market share and product portfolios. This strategic consolidation targets niche markets and drives rapid technology adoption. These investment activities provide significant competitive edges by integrating artificial intelligence (AI), machine learning (ML), and natural language processing (NLP) into BI solutions. These technologies have proven essential for automated data analysis, enhancing efficiency and streamlining business processes. Moving forward, the BI software industry seeks to capitalize on the growing potential of AI to drive revenue up at a CAGR of 3.5% to $39.1 billion. As businesses rely on data to make business decisions, they will demand enhanced real-time features that incorporate predictive AI to allow them to make immediate decisions. As industry participants prioritize efficiency and data security in their product offerings, they will solidify their indispensable role in contemporary business operations. This will lead to favorable margins moving forward. While the BI software sector remains highly dynamic with stiff competition, companies focusing on rapid technology adoption, strategic M&A activities and catering to SME needs are poised to benefit immensely from this ongoing digital transformation. Such forward-thinking strategies will open new opportunities and drive continual innovation within the industry.
